There are two components used to show dialogs: Dialog and AlertDialog. The Dialog component is a general dialog where you can put any content while the AlertDialog has some default styles that make it easy to show errors, warnings or questions to the user.

To show or hide the dialog the isOpen prop is used.

Notification methods

The ons.notification object contains some useful methods to easily show alerts, confirmation dialogs and prompts:

  • ons.notification.alert(message, options)
  • ons.notificaiton.confirm(message, options)
  • ons.notification.prompt(message, options)

They all return a Promise object that can be used to handle the input from the user.

名前 型 / デフォルト値 概要
modifier string The appearance of the action sheet button. (翻訳中) Optional.
icon string Creates an Icon component with this string. Only visible on Android. (翻訳中) Optional.
onClick function This function will be called when the button is clicked. (翻訳中) Optional.


Name 概要
destructive “destructive”なボタンを表示します(iOSでのみ有効)。
material マテリアルデザインのアクションシート用のボタンを表示します。


